Commit Message

Prasanna Kumar Kalever Nov. 10, 2015, 9:09 a.m. UTC
this patch is very much be meaningful after next patch which adds multiple
gluster servers support. After that,

an example is, in  'servers' tuple values we use 'server' variable for key
'host' in the code, it will be quite messy to have colliding names for
variables, so to maintain better readability and makes it consistent with other
existing code as well as the input keys/options, this patch renames the
following variables
'server'  -> 'host'
'image'   -> 'path'
'volname' -> 'volume'

When this has been previously positively reviewed, and you are making no
further changes to the code, it speeds up review to add the reviewer's
line to your commit message (so that the reviewer knows it is unchanged,
and so that other readers know it has been reviewed at least once).  Of
course, if you change a patch, dropping the R-b line is appropriate.
